Microsoft Dynamics plugin for Kaholo
Settings
- Authority URL – The authority URL to authenticate with. (Default: https://login.microsoftonline.com/common/oauth2/nativeclient)
- Client ID – The client ID of the app registered to AD.
- Username – The username to authenticate
- Password – The user password
- Resource – The dynamics resource (i.e. https://xxx.crm.dynamics.com)
Method: Export Solution
Description:
Exports a solution to a zip file.
You can see further information on ExportSolution documentation.
Parameters:
- Output Path – The zip output path.
- Solution Name – The unique name of the solution.
- Managed – Indicates whether the solution should be exported as a managed solution.
- Export Auto Numbering – Indicates whether auto numbering settings should be included in the solution being exported.
- Export Calendar – Indicates whether calendar settings should be included in the solution being exported
- Export Customization – Indicates whether customization settings should be included in the solution being exported.
- Export Email Tracking – Indicates whether email tracking settings should be included in the solution being exported.
- Export General – Indicates whether general settings should be included in the solution being exported.
- Export Marketing – Indicates whether marketing settings should be included in the solution being exported.
- Export Outlook Synchronization – Indicates whether outlook synchronization settings should be included in the solution being exported.
- Export Relationship Roles – Indicates whether relationship role settings should be included in the solution being exported.
- Export ISV Config – Indicates whether ISV.Config settings should be included in the solution being exported.
- Export Sales – Indicates whether sales settings should be included in the solution being exported.
- Export External Applications – Indicates whether external applications should be included in the solution being exported.
Method: Import Solution
Description:
Imports a solution from an export zip file.
You can see further information on ImportSolution documentation.
Parameters:
- ZIP Path – The path to the zip file
- importJobId – The ID of the import job that will be created to perform the import. (Default: auto generated v4 UUID)
- Overwrite Unmanaged Customizations – Indicates whether any unmanaged customizations that have been applied over existing managed solution components should be overwritten
- Publish Workflows – Indicates whether any processes (workflows) included in the solution should be activated after they are imported.
- Convert To Managed – Converts any matching unmanaged customizations into your managed solution.
- Skip Product Update Dependencies – Indicates whether enforcement of dependencies related to product updates should be skipped.
